Etiquette

There are a few etiquette rules that you should keep in mind when planning and attending a stag weekend. Here are some of the most significant ones:

Ultimately, the stag weekend is about the groom, so it’s important to respect his wishes. If there’s something that he’s not comfortable with, don’t push him to do it.

Remember that you’re representing the groom, so be respectful of others while you’re out and about. Don’t cause any unnecessary trouble or act inappropriately.

While it’s important to have a plan in place, it’s also important to be flexible. Things may not go according to plan, and that’s okay. Be open to changing your itinerary if necessary.
